✦ Synopsis
A normalized two-dimensional 2-D multile¨el fast multi-( ) ( ) pole algorithm MLFMA with a computational complexity of O N for ( ) the quasistatic ¨ery low-frequency case is de¨eloped. This normalized 2-D MLFMA can be used not only independently as in the quasi-static case, but also to sol¨e large-scale structures with dense subgridded areas when combined with a dynamic algorithm. The null-space problem for boundary integral equations at ¨ery low frequencies is also studied.
